Kitchen cabinet refinishing is a process that involves restoring the appearance of existing cabinets without the need for complete replacement. This service typically includes cleaning, sanding, repairing minor damages, and applying new paint, stain, or finish to give cabinets a fresh, updated look. Refinishing can be a practical way to revitalize a kitchen’s style, making cabinets look brand new while saving money compared to buying and installing new ones. Many local contractors offer this service to help homeowners achieve a more modern or classic aesthetic with minimal disruption to their daily routines.
This service addresses common problems such as worn, scratched, or faded cabinet surfaces that can make a kitchen appear outdated or neglected. Over time, cabinets can accumulate stains, chips, or peeling paint, diminishing the overall appeal of the space. Refinishing can effectively hide these imperfections and extend the lifespan of existing cabinetry. It is also a solution for homeowners who want to update their kitchen’s color scheme or style without undertaking a full remodel, providing a cost-effective way to improve the room’s appearance.

The overview below groups typical Kitchen Cabinet Refinishing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Most minor refinishing jobs, such as touch-ups or repainting cabinets, typically cost between $250 and $600. These projects are common and often fall within the middle of this range, depending on the size and condition of the cabinets.
Mid-Range Projects - Repainting or refinishing entire kitchen cabinets usually ranges from $1,000 to $3,000. Many local contractors handle projects in this band, which covers standard kitchens with moderate complexity.
Large or Custom Jobs - Larger, more detailed refinishing projects can reach $3,500 to $5,000 or more. Fewer projects fall into this highest tier, typically involving custom finishes or extensive cabinet modifications.
Full Replacement - Complete cabinet replacement costs are generally higher, often exceeding $5,000. This option is less common for refinishing services but may be recommended for heavily damaged or outdated kitchens.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is kitchen cabinet refinishing? Kitchen cabinet refinishing involves applying a new finish or paint to existing cabinets to refresh their appearance without replacing them.
Can refinishing change the color or style of my cabinets? Yes, refinishing allows for color changes and updates to cabinet styles through various painting and staining techniques.
Is refinishing a good option for damaged cabinets? Refinishing can improve the look of cabinets with minor damage, but severely damaged or structurally compromised cabinets may require replacement.
What types of finishes are available for cabinet refinishing? Service providers typically offer a range of finishes, including matte, semi-gloss, high-gloss, and distressed looks, to match different design preferences.
